Thank you.
What about the trannys ?
It's the 4R75, which used to be in the F150 5.4L. It's generally reliable. Not as robust as the 5R110, but for the most part, trouble free, even in 4x4 rigs as long as they were re-geared for for bigger tires. I've seen some folks needing a replacement after 100,000 miles, but I don't think that's the norm.

Thanks CarringB for helping with the info!

Honestly I dont know about the fuel mileage because I only have 600 miles on the van since converting it but I wouldnt even worry about what it is right now because I think if someone was going to drive this in the PNW they would want to regear the van to 4:10s or 4:30s. If this van will be used anywhere flat like AZ, TX or CA then the 3.73 would be fine.
